This websiste do a infiite loop and its impossible to leave the program.

https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/windowsinsider/leave-program?ocid=aem_eml_nl_202607_july-newsletter-112_leave-program

Whether this leave action is triggered by settings->leave windows insider program or type the mentioned URL in web browser, it's same. It asked me to login, after that is hangs in the URL."

The web page simply hangs and never returns. I was never given any option to choose anything.

I just clicked 'leave insider' from windows "settings->leave windows insider program" which directs me to URL https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/windowsinsider/leave-program .

I also typed the URL directly in 3 different browsers, the web page always hang with a blank screen and never show any results.

I ALSO CHECKED

Windows Update, Windows Insider = THIS IS NOT ACTIVATED

Registry key:

H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\WindowsSelfHost key

THIS WAS ALREADY DELETE + I DID A FORMAT and INSTALL A normal BUILD

Still getting Windows Insider email, and still the website spins in a infinite loop !
